Is Jolly Rancher Peach Zero Sugar Gluten Free?
Yes, Jolly Rancher Peach Zero Sugar is gluten-free. Based on the ingredient list provided by the manufacturer, there are no wheat, barley, rye, or gluten-containing derivatives used in this specific flavor. This beverage relies on carbonated water and artificial sweeteners to achieve its taste, making it a safe option for those avoiding gluten.
The Ingredient Breakdown
As a food scientist, I look beyond the marketing claims to the molecular level of what we consume. The formula for Jolly Rancher Peach Zero Sugar is designed to deliver intense flavor without the caloric load of sugar. The primary vehicle is carbonated water, which is naturally gluten-free. The flavor profile comes from a combination of natural and artificial flavors. In the food industry, these flavoring agents are typically derived from non-gluten sources, especially for fruit profiles like peach.
The sweetness is achieved through a blend of high-intensity sweeteners: sucralose and acesulfame potassium. These are synthetic compounds that do not contain any gluten proteins. For preservation, the drink utilizes sodium benzoate and potassium sorbate. These are chemical preservatives that prevent microbial growth and are strictly gluten-free. Finally, the color comes from beta carotene, a plant-derived pigment, and the vitamin fortification includes niacinamide, pyridoxine hydrochloride (Vitamin B6), and cyanocobalamin (Vitamin B12). None of these micronutrients are sourced from gluten-containing grains.
While the formula is chemically gluten-free, it is important to note that the product is manufactured in facilities that may handle other allergens. However, based on the specific ingredients listed for this beverage, there are no direct gluten flags.
Nutritional Value
From a nutritional standpoint, Jolly Rancher Peach Zero Sugar is a 'free' product—meaning it is free of sugar, fat, and significant calories. A standard 12oz can typically contains 0 calories and 0g of sugar. This is achieved by replacing sucrose with sucralose and acesulfame potassium. For individuals monitoring their glycemic index or managing diabetes, this beverage is a viable option as it does not spike blood glucose levels.
However, the presence of caffeine (usually around 50mg per serving) and artificial sweeteners should be considered. While the FDA classifies these ingredients as safe, some individuals prefer to limit their intake of synthetic additives. The vitamin fortification (B3, B6, B12) offers a minor energy-boosting benefit, but the drink should not be relied upon as a primary source of nutrition.
